Finance Review Summary — Licensing Dispute, Hallowick Components

The dispute with Tessmark Industrial over the Corvid-9 licence remains unresolved. Our exposure is estimated at mid six figures, with accrued provisions booked in Q3. Counsel advises settlement is likelier than arbitration, and cash-flow impact would fall in the next fiscal year. The finance team should note the planning implication recorded below.

confidential, hawif-kagup: Only 16 of the 552 pilot accounts renewed Ralix, so a churn review is set for November 1. Quenysox Group is in early talks to buy Ralethix Partners for about $63.3 million.

**Q: Thumbnail queue is backing up. What do I check first?**

Check the Snapmill worker pool. If workers are alive but idle, the broker lease table is likely wedged — restart the lease reaper, not the workers. Backlogs over 50k items usually mean a poison message; quarantine it via the admin CLI. Escalate to the Glintframe team only after that. Full runbook with commands lives here.

runbook for badug-kadup: https://confluence.zemvarlabs.internal/projects/browse/display/projects/bd1b

[ ] Step 7 — Restore extraction signing key. Before the Lintbarrow key ceremony concludes, confirm the translation-string extraction script (strex.py) is signed with the new ceremony key and that the old key is revoked in the manifest. Two witnesses must initial the log. If the signing HSM prompts for recovery during this step, enter the recovery passphrase shown immediately below.

unlock words, fafop-hawep: briwyn-oliix-sorox